The high plains climate in Scottsbluff, with its hot summers, cold winters, and occasional dusty winds, can accelerate wear on certain Audi components. Common local issues include premature battery failure due to temperature extremes, increased suspension and CV joint wear from rough rural roads, and clogged cabin air filters from agricultural dust.
Look for a shop that employs technicians certified by ASE (Automotive Service Excellence) with specific European or Audi training. In Scottsbluff, it's also wise to ask if the shop has direct experience with the specific electronic systems and tooling required for modern Audis, as not all general repair shops have this specialized capability locally.
While parts costs are generally fixed, labor rates in Scottsbluff may be slightly lower than in major metropolitan areas. However, specialized Audi repairs still command a premium; for example, a standard brake service may range from $350-$600, while more complex electrical diagnostics can start at $150+ for labor alone, before parts.
For routine maintenance (oil changes, brakes, tires) and many common repairs, a qualified local Scottsbluff shop is perfectly capable and more convenient. However, for major warranty work, complex drivetrain control module programming, or recall campaigns that require proprietary dealer software, a trip to an authorized Audi dealership may be necessary.
Given the long distances to major service centers, establishing a relationship with a trusted local specialist for preventative maintenance is crucial. Pay extra attention to coolant mixture strength for winter, tire condition for highway travel to remote areas, and consider a higher-quality fuel additive occasionally due to the limited availability of top-tier gasoline stations in the region.
